More Than Just Adding and Dividing

At its core, an average is the sum of a set of numbers divided by how many numbers there are. Types of Averages and When to Use Each

The word "average" is surprisingly ambiguous in everyday language. Most people mean the arithmetic mean - add everything up, divide by the count. That's appropriate when your values are evenly distributed and there are no extreme outliers. The Average Calculator computes this automatically whenever you enter a set of numbers.

But the mean can be misleading. If five employees at a startup earn $40K, $42K, $45K, $48K, and $500K (the founder), the mean salary is $135K - a number that describes nobody's actual pay. The median (the middle value when sorted) is $45K, which better represents the typical employee's experience. Understanding when to report mean versus median is a crucial statistical literacy skill, and this calculator gives you both.

The mode - the most frequently occurring value - matters in different contexts. A shoe store analyzing its sales data cares most about which size sells most often (the mode), not the average shoe size, because that's what determines stocking decisions.

Everyday Scenarios for Average Calculation

Academic grading is perhaps the most universal use case. A student with test scores of 88, 72, 95, 84, and 91 needs to know their average heading into finals. The average calculator shows that's 86.0 - a solid B. Teachers with classes of 30 students calculating semester averages save enormous time by pasting all the scores in at once.

Personal finance benefits from averages too. What's your average monthly spending on groceries over the past year? Enter all twelve months and find out. That number becomes the baseline for your budget, and deviations from it signal months where spending got out of hand.

Sports statistics are built on averages. A basketball player's points per game, a baseball player's batting average, a soccer team's average goals per match - these are all arithmetic means, and fans, coaches, and analysts compute them constantly.

Quality control in manufacturing uses averages to monitor process stability. If the average diameter of machined parts drifts outside the tolerance window, something in the process has changed and needs investigation.

Additional Statistics Beyond the Average

Alongside the mean, median, and mode, this tool typically displays the sum (useful as a sanity check), the count (confirming how many values were entered), the minimum and maximum (identifying outliers), and the range (max minus min, indicating spread). These supplementary statistics provide context that a bare average number lacks.

For instance, two datasets can have the same average but wildly different ranges. Test scores of 80, 80, 80 average to 80, as do scores of 60, 80, 100. The range reveals that the second group is far more variable, which has implications for how you interpret and act on that average.
